Hi guys,
I thought I should say hello as I've just picked up another mk5 TDI and will be using this forum a lot more now.

Picked this up in pretty much standard condition bar the wheels complete with rotten wing.

So far I've sorted the rust, chucked on the 18's after a home refurb, sorted the heater blower, cleaned and painted all the calipers and replaced the scubby looking headlight switch for a new one and fitted the missing headlight rubber grommet, repaired a window regulator and enjoyed it.

Got a little more progress today, I ordered a new set of GTI skirts from TPS the other day and managed to get them fitted after work.

Was an easy job but I was a little nervous when fitting as you need to screw on a fixing strip either side which has 9 bolts, so it was a case of measure, check, measure, check and go for it.

 

here's the results anyhoo, I'm rather pleased with it.
